RFG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

88 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co S&P MidCap 400 Pure Growth ETF (RFG)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$110M — down 3.2% from $113M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new RFG posit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 16 added to existing stakes and 23 trimmed.

The largest buyer was LPL Financial, adding an estimated $2.23M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$6.37M.
